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or Specification

The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or is a robust and versatile lawn tractor designed for homeowners seeking efficiency and reliability in lawn maintenance. Powered by a 10.5 HP Briggs & Stratton engine, this machine ensures consistent performance and durability. It features a 38-inch cutting deck, which provides a wide cutting path to reduce mowing time on medium to large lawns. The cutting deck is constructed of durable steel, enhancing its longevity and resistance to wear.

Equipped with a six-speed manual transmission, the PO10538LT offers precise control and adaptability to various terrains and mowing conditions. The tractor's ergonomic design includes an adjustable high-back seat and a user-friendly control layout, ensuring operator comfort during extended use. Additionally, the tractor's 18-inch turning radius allows for excellent maneuverability around obstacles and tight corners.

The Poulan Pro PO10538LT also incorporates a convenient deck washout port, simplifying maintenance and cleaning to extend the life of the cutting deck. Its 3-gallon fuel tank provides ample capacity for longer mowing sessions without frequent refueling. The tractor's tires are designed for optimal traction and minimal turf damage, ensuring a smooth and efficient mowing experience.

Safety features include an operator presence system that automatically shuts off the engine if the operator leaves the seat, reducing the risk of accidents.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or F.A.Q.

How do I start the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

To start the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or, ensure that the parking brake is set, the PTO is disengaged, and the gear shift is in neutral. Insert the key and turn it to the start position until the engine fires, then release the key.

What type of oil should I use for the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

Use SAE 30 motor oil for temperatures above 32°F and SAE 5W-30 for temperatures below 32°F. Always check the owner's manual for specific recommendations.

How often should I change the oil in my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

Change the oil after the first 5 hours of use, then every 25 hours of operation or at least once a season.

What should I do if the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or won't start?

Check the battery connections, ensure there is fresh fuel, inspect the spark plug, and make sure the PTO is disengaged and the parking brake is set.

How do I replace the blade on the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

First, ensure the tractor is turned off and the spark plug wire is disconnected. Use a wrench to remove the blade bolt, then replace with a new blade, ensuring it is tightly secured.

What is the correct tire pressure for the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

The recommended tire pressure is 14 PSI for the front tires and 10 PSI for the rear tires. Always check the manual for precise specifications.

How do I clean the air filter on the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

Remove the air filter cover, take out the filter, and gently clean it with warm soapy water if it's foam, or replace if it's paper. Make sure it is dry before reinstalling.

What should I do if the tractor's engine is overheating?

Check for debris in the cooling fins and clean them, ensure the engine oil level is adequate, and inspect the belts for proper tension.

How do I engage the blade on the Poulan Pro PO10538LT Tractor?

To engage the blade, ensure the engine is running, then pull the PTO lever up to activate the mower deck.

What maintenance should be performed before storing the tractor for winter?

Before storing, clean the tractor, change the oil, add a fuel stabilizer, remove the battery, and store it in a cool dry place. Cover the tractor to protect it from dust and moisture.
